Things to Do around East Renton Highlands

East Renton Highlands is an unincorporated community in King County, Washington, characterized by a diverse landscape of forests, wetlands, and river valleys. The area's varied terrain, including views of the Cascade Mountains and proximity to the Cedar River, provides a setting for outdoor activities. East Renton Highlands offers opportunities for several sports like hiking, mountain biking, road cycling, jogging, and more.

What outdoor activities are available in East Renton Highlands?

East Renton Highlands offers a variety of outdoor activities including Hiking, Mountain biking, Road cycling, Jogging, Touring cycling, and Gravel biking. What are the best hiking trails in East Renton Highlands?

Popular hiking trails include the May Valley Loop at Squak Mountain State Park, a moderate 4.4-mile (7.1 km) route, and the Coal Creek Falls loop in Cougar Mountain Regional Wildland Park. The Licorice Fern Trail also offers an 8.7-mile (14.0 km) forested experience. More details can be found in the Hiking around East Renton Highlands guide.

Are there easy hiking trails for beginners in East Renton Highlands?

Yes, options like the May Valley Short Loop in Squak Mountain State Park provide accessible paths. The Cedar River Trail also offers less strenuous walking opportunities. For more choices, consult the Easy hikes around East Renton Highlands guide.

Where can I find mountain biking trails in East Renton Highlands?

Tiger Mountain is a key destination for mountain biking, featuring challenging routes like the Master Link and Predator Loop, which is 5.9 miles (9.4 km). Another option is the Tiger Mountain Road, Off-The-Grid, Joyride, and Northwest Timber Loop, spanning 9.1 miles (14.7 km). Explore more in the MTB Trails around East Renton Highlands guide.

What are the popular road cycling routes in East Renton Highlands?

Road cyclists can enjoy routes such as the Green Valley Loop, a moderate 60.5-mile (97.4 km) ride with 2,433 feet of elevation gain. The Cedar River and Interurban Trails Loop combines two trails for a 46.0-mile (74.0 km) ride. The Lake Washington Loop also offers 30.8 miles (49.6 km) of scenic views. Refer to the Road Cycling Routes around East Renton Highlands guide for more.

Are there good jogging routes in East Renton Highlands?

East Renton Highlands provides various jogging experiences. Squak Mountain State Park offers routes like the Equestrian Running Loop, which is 5.8 miles (9.4 km). The Coal Creek Falls loop from Ravenswood in Cougar Mountain Regional Wildland Park is another option, covering 7.4 miles (12.0 km). The Running Trails around East Renton Highlands guide has additional information.

Are there family-friendly outdoor routes in East Renton Highlands?

Yes, several routes are suitable for families. Easy hiking options like the May Valley Short Loop in Squak Mountain State Park are available. Heritage Park also features an easy loop around its playfields, providing a less strenuous option for all ages.

What natural features or viewpoints can be seen on trails in East Renton Highlands?

Trails in East Renton Highlands often wind through extensive forests, wetlands, and river valleys, such as along the Cedar River. Many routes offer views of the Cascade Mountains and are close to Lake Washington. Debbie's View on Squak Mountain provides a notable scenic outlook.

What is the terrain like for outdoor activities in East Renton Highlands?

The terrain in East Renton Highlands is diverse, featuring extensive forests, wetlands, and river valleys. It includes varied elevation, from accessible paths to more challenging routes with significant gains, particularly in areas like Squak Mountain and Tiger Mountain. This variety supports different activity levels and sports.
